Oh, how exciting! Three days in Moscow will be a wonderful adventure. Let's plan your itinerary:
Start your day with a visit to the iconic Red Square. Marvel at the beauty of St. Basil's Cathedral and take a stroll around the square to soak in the history and architecture. Next, head to the Kremlin, the historical and political heart of Russia. Explore the cathedrals, museums, and the Armoury Chamber.
For lunch, indulge in some traditional Russian cuisine at a local restaurant. Afterward, visit the Bolshoi Theatre, one of the most famous cultural institutions in Russia. If you're lucky, you might even catch a ballet or opera performance.
In the evening, take a leisurely walk along Arbat Street, a bustling pedestrian street filled with shops, cafes, and street performers. Don't forget to pick up some souvenirs!
Start your day with a visit to the Tretyakov Gallery, home to an extensive collection of Russian art, including works by famous artists like Repin, Kandinsky, and Malevich. Spend a few hours exploring the gallery and immersing yourself in Russian art history.
For lunch, head to Gorky Park, a popular recreational spot in Moscow. Enjoy a picnic by the pond or rent a bike to explore the park's vast grounds.
In the afternoon, visit the Cathedral of Christ the Saviour, the tallest Orthodox church in the world. Climb to the top for panoramic views of the city.
In the evening, take a relaxing boat cruise along the Moskva River. Enjoy the stunning views of Moscow's skyline illuminated at night.
Start your day with a visit to the Moscow Metro. Explore the stunning architecture and artwork of the metro stations, often referred to as "underground palaces."
Next, visit the Pushkin Museum of Fine Arts, which houses an impressive collection of European art, including works by Rembrandt, Van Gogh, and Picasso.
For lunch, head to a traditional Russian tea room and indulge in some delicious pastries and tea.
In the afternoon, visit the Sparrow Hills for panoramic views of Moscow and the Moscow State University campus.
In the evening, treat yourself to a traditional Russian dinner at a cozy restaurant, complete with vodka and caviar.
I hope this itinerary helps you make the most of your three days in Moscow. Enjoy your trip!
